🎮
Unityとは
Unityの概要
Unityは、2D/3Dゲーム開発、VR/ARコンテンツ制作、映画やアニメーション制作など、幅広い用途に使用できるゲームエンジン
C#やJavaScriptなどのプログラミング言語を使って、インタラクティブなコンテンツを開発できる
主な機能
- リアルタイムレンダリング: 高精細な3Dグラフィックをリアルタイムで描画できる
- 物理シミュレーション: リアルな物理挙動を再現することができる
- アニメーション: キャラクターやオブジェクトにアニメーションをつけることができる
- オーディオ: 音声や音楽を再生することができる
- AI: 敵キャラクターやNPCの行動を制御することができる
- マルチプラットフォーム対応: 開発したコンテンツを、PC、スマートフォン、ゲーム機など、様々なプラットフォームで動作させることができる
チュートリアル
Unityには、初心者向けから上級者向けまで、様々なチュートリアルが用意されている
Unity公式チュートリアル: https://www.youtube.com/watch?v=XtQMytORBmM
Unityちゃん公式チュートリアル: https://www.youtube.com/watch?v=XtQMytORBmM
Brackeys: https://brackeys.com/
Blackthornprod: https://www.blackthornprod.com/
歴史
- Unityは、2005年にデンマークの会社Unity Technologiesによって開発された
- 当初はMac OS X向けのゲームエンジンとして開発されましたが、
- その後WindowsやLinuxにも対応し、
- 現在では世界中で最も人気のあるゲームエンジンの一つとなっている
まとめ
Unityは、初心者から上級者まで、幅広い開発者が利用できるゲームエンジンです。豊富なチュートリアルやサンプルコードが用意されているので、ゲーム開発を始めるのに最適です。
Discussion